About Swoosh
Swoosh is a casual platformer that lets you use 2D physics to traverse its levels, from bouncing, rolling, pulling and sticking get through a level to get to the next. There are different types of surfaces which can be identified by their colour, sticky red, border blue, impassable purple and so on. The game relies on some experimentation from the player to find a way through some levels or getting the right combination of power and angle to get to the next platform. Not much more to it pure and simple game to spend some spare time.

A fantastic callback to the Flash era of challenging platformers. Great to have installed for offline play or during a big download while you have 20 minutes to spare. The physics are sound and interesting, with new elements being introduced consistently as you move through the levels. the maps also offer opportunities to find new and, often very challenging, alternative ways to complete each level. I have spent a significant amount of my time in this game dying again and again to find the perfect angles and timings to speedrun a level. Some levels can be significantly challenging at times but it is manageable, so that finally passing the level feels highly rewarding. (I've honestly needed to shower a couple of times after the stress of this game). There is also a custom map creator tool in development which needs some work but shows promise. Put this together with the times and scoreboards and you have yourself a very competitive game style, vaguely similar to "Golf With Friends" and other party games, perfect to wash away Quarantine boredom. Overall verdict: 7.5/10. Will go up to 8.5 once the map creator tool is finish and some mechanic tweaking occurs.1 found this helpful
